ADHD Test Online for Adults: An Informative Guide

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that affects countless adults worldwide. While it is typically connected with children, lots of do not understand that ADHD can persist into the adult years, resulting in difficulties in expert and personal life. Luckily, online testing for ADHD has become a feasible alternative for adults looking for to evaluate their symptoms. This post will explore the process of online ADHD testing, its benefits, restrictions, and regularly asked questions.

Comprehending ADHD in Adults

ADHD provides differently in adults than in kids. Symptoms might consist of:

  • Inattention
  • Hyperactivity
  • Impulsivity
  • Trouble maintaining focus
  • Trouble organizing jobs
  • Lapse of memory
  • Restlessness

ADHD can substantially impact an individual's work efficiency, relationships, and general quality of life. Therefore, determining the condition early and looking for proper intervention is crucial.

What is an Online ADHD Test?

An online ADHD test is a preliminary screening tool that helps people examine whether they might have ADHD. These tests generally include a series of self-report questionnaires assessing various behavioral patterns and symptoms connected with ADHD.

Functions of Online ADHD Tests

Online ADHD tests are designed to be easy to use and provide fast insights. Here are some common functions:

  1. Questionnaires: Self-report questionnaires covering numerous symptoms.
  2. Instantaneous Results: Many tests provide immediate feedback on possible ADHD symptoms.
  3. Confidentiality: Most online tests are conducted in a protected and personal way.
  4. Availability: Available anytime, making them hassle-free for individuals with hectic schedules.

Limitations of Online ADHD Tests

While online ADHD tests can be useful, they are not without constraints:

  1. Not a Diagnostic Tool: Online tests are suggested for initial screening and do not offer an official diagnosis.
  2. Irregularity in Validity: The precision of tests can differ, depending on their style and the person's sincerity in answering.
  3. Lack of Personalized Assessment: They do not represent co-occurring conditions or unique personal circumstances.
  4. Require Follow-Up: A favorable outcome should lead to an assessment with a doctor for a thorough examination.

How to Choose the Right Online ADHD Test

Choosing a trusted online ADHD test is important for obtaining precise insights into one's symptoms. Here are some pointers for making the right option:

  • Look for Validity: Choose tests that are backed by research study or developed by professionals in psychology or psychiatry.
  • Check Reviews: Read testimonials or evaluations from other users to gauge the test's reliability.
  • Think about Recommendations: Seek tests recommended by health care experts.
  • Review Content: Ensure the test covers a series of symptoms and behaviors related to ADHD.

Actions After Taking the Online Test

If an individual gets a high score indicating prospective ADHD symptoms:

  1. Schedule a Consultation: Contact a psychological health specialist for an official evaluation.
  2. Prepare for the Meeting: Bring arise from the online test and any pertinent individual history or paperwork.
  3. Talk About Treatment Options: Explore possible management techniques, which might consist of therapy, medication, or lifestyle modifications.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are online ADHD tests precise?

While numerous online tests can offer beneficial preliminary insights, they must not be thought about definitive medical diagnoses. Constantly consult a qualified healthcare expert for an official assessment.

2. Can I take an ADHD test for free?

Yes, numerous online ADHD tests are available totally free. However, make sure that they are trustworthy and based upon validated research study.

3. What should I do if I believe I have ADHD?

If you believe you may have ADHD, take an online screening test for a preliminary assessment, and seek advice from with a health care specialist for more evaluation and medical diagnosis.

4. For how long does an online ADHD test take?

Many online tests generally take between 10-30 minutes to complete, depending upon the intricacy of the concerns.

5. Can ADHD symptoms alter gradually?

Yes, ADHD symptoms can develop with age, and what may have been thought about hyper in childhood might present as restlessness or inattention in the adult years.
